5 , 6 , 9 In addition, a weak trend of monocyte HLA-DR recovery was associated with secondary infection and poor prognosis. 27 , 28 Moreover, monocyte PD-L1 overexpression was also recognised as an independent risk factor during septic shock. 7 PD-L1 on monocytes could bind to PD-1 on effector T cells and suppress T-cell receptor signalling, leading to T-cell anergy, apoptosis and exhaustion. 29 – 33 Thus, the results indicated that patients with sepsis had a dysregulated monocyte immune response, predisposing the host to a dangerous situation upon infection.
